Ajinomoto Co. (OTCMKTS:AJINY - Get Free Report) shares gapped down prior to trading on Monday . The stock had previously closed at $28.83, but opened at $27.73. Ajinomoto shares last traded at $27.73, with a volume of 132 shares traded.

Ajinomoto Stock Up 0.2%

The company has a current ratio of 1.59, a quick ratio of 0.93 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.54. The stock's 50-day simple moving average is $27.27 and its 200-day simple moving average is $28.10. The firm has a market capitalization of $28.80 billion, a P/E ratio of 48.16 and a beta of 0.52.

Ajinomoto (OTCMKTS:AJINY -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Monday, August 4th. The company reported $0.23 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.21 by $0.02. Ajinomoto had a net margin of 6.02% and a return on equity of 10.45%. The business had revenue of $2.47 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.69 billion.

Ajinomoto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Ajinomoto Co, Inc engages in the seasonings and foods, frozen foods, and healthcare and other businesses in Japan and internationally. The Seasonings and Foods segment offers sauces and seasoning products under the AJI-NO-MOTO, HON-DASHI, Cook Do, Ajinomoto KK Consommé, Pure Select Mayonnaise, Ros Dee, Masako, Aji-ngon, Sazón, Sajiku, and CRISPY FRY names; and solutions and ingredients for foodservice and processed food manufacturers, processed foods, and restaurants, as well as industrial, retail, and other applications.
